**Q: How does roll call work during a fire drill?**

All staff muster at the Pellworth Court car park, marker B. Facilities desk brings the printed register and a tablet. Tick names as people arrive; flag anyone missing to the warden immediately. Visitors are counted separately. To re-enter the building after the all-clear, use the re-entry code below.

staff pass of kawip-hawef = bdg-QLP-2

Release checklist — item 7: health checks behind the Kestrelgate load balancer. Before promoting, confirm the new /ready endpoint returns 200 only after the cache warmer finishes; the old endpoint lied during warmup and the balancer routed traffic into cold nodes, which caused the Brindle launch wobble. Verify drain timeout is set above the warmer's worst-case duration, and that both availability zones report healthy independently. Reviewer should sign off only after comparing the deployed artifact against the reference noted below.

trace token, yafog-bafop: htk31_90e4e3962168bb1bf8de5dfe86ea527

**Ticket QDA-412: Signature check failing on autoscaler bundle**

So the Thrumwell queue-depth autoscaler started rejecting its own config bundles last night — every deploy bounces with a bad-signature error. Dug into it and it's not tampering: the verifier pod was still pinned to the key we retired during the Marrowgate cleanup. Nobody updated the trust store on the scaler side. Fix is straightforward — roll the trust store and re-sign the current bundle. For the reviewer's records, the key the bundles are now signed with is below.

signing key of hahog-kagug = bky3_vdF

## Deploying the Gatewick Proctor Queue

Deploys are pretty painless: push to main, wait for the pipeline, then watch the queue drain dashboard for five minutes. If candidates pile up mid-exam, roll back first and ask questions later — the queue replays safely. Everything the workers care about lives in one config block, shown here for reference.

settings of bafof-yagef:
JOROX_PIN=8740
JOROX_TENANT=pelox
JOROX_METRICS_HOST=metrics.jorox.qorvelworks.internal
JOROX_SEAL=seal_c78f63c1
JOROX_STANDBY_TEAM=norax